Fear vs. Safety: Two Completely Different Businesses
Here’s what this looks like in real life.
You launch something. It doesn’t convert immediately. You watch your budget shrink and your results stay flat. Stress creeps in. You start making decisions from that stressed, anxious place, pivoting too fast, spending on things that don’t matter, reacting instead of leading.
That’s what building from fear looks like.
Now imagine the opposite. You wake up grounded. You’ve already connected to the deeper reason you’re doing this, maybe it’s stability, security, the freedom to never worry about an income again. You start your day in that emotional state. And from there, you make decisions. Marketing decisions. Hiring decisions. Pricing decisions.
That’s building from safety.
Same external circumstances. Completely different outcomes.
Because here’s the truth about the entrepreneurial mindset that nobody puts in their course: your emotion determines your mindset. Your mindset determines your decisions. Your decisions build your business.
Get the emotion wrong, and no amount of strategy will save you.
What Entrepreneurs Who Last Actually Do in the Morning
The most resilient entrepreneurs, the ones who don’t burn out, don’t scatter, don’t give up three months in, share one thing in common. They don’t start their day by immediately consuming. They start by returning to themselves.
Before the scroll. Before the inbox. Before the meetings.
They create a morning practice that does three things:
- Grounds the nervous system. Your body needs to feel safe before your mind can think clearly. Meditation, breathwork, stillness — whatever it takes to signal to your brain: we are not in danger.
- Reconnects to the vision. Not the tactics. Not the to-do list. The deeper why — the feeling your dream is supposed to create. Write it down. Sit with it. Let it become real.
- Sets the emotional foundation for the day. Then, and only then, you begin working. Not from stress. Not from urgency. From that anchored, clear, safe place.
This is what it means to build a business from nervous system regulation — and it changes everything.
